#f54ef8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f54ef8 is composed of 96.1% red, 30.6%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.2% cyan, 68.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 298.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.4% and a lightness of 63.9%. #f54ef8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cff with #eb00f1. Closest websafe color is: #ff66ff.

#f54ef8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f54ef8 has RGB values of R:245, G:78,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16076536.

Shades and Tints of #f54ef8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b000c is the darkest color, while #fff8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f54ef8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a3a3 is the less saturated color, while #f54ef8 is the most saturated one.
